java StringBuilder 和 StringBuffer

1, 相对于 String 来说, StringBuilder 和 StringBuffer 均是可变的

2, StringBuilder 线程不安全, StringBuffer 线程安全

3, 运行速度 StringBuilder  > StringBuffer > String

4, 常用方法

SN(序号) 方法描述
1

StringBuilder append(T t)

StringBuffer append(T t)

把布尔值/字节/字节数组/小数/整数添加到末尾

2

int indexOf(String str)

子串首次出现的索引

3

int lastIndexOf(String str)

子串最后一次出现的索引

4

Char charAt(int index)

返回指定索引处的字符

5

int length()

返回字符长度

6

String toString()

返回对应的 String

7

String subString(int start)

String subString(int start, int end)

截取字符串返回子串, 前闭后开, 如果只有一个参数就截取到末尾

 

  

 

posted @ 2018-10-13 17:02  huanggy  阅读(148)  评论(0编辑  收藏  举报